Trends: Progressive Education Then And Now

EdConnections Posted by Dan S. Martin
Speaking of the forties, the tug between traditional and progressive education models is not a new one in America.  Nor is the instinct for education reform.  Is project-based instruction today's progressive education?  Just what is progressive education in 2011?  Is it compatible with the accountability movement?  Has the traditional model of education won out?  Is technology part of the answer?  Where to from here?  Or, as asked in previous posts, what exactly do we want from our schools?

The footage below is seven minutes of "the more things change, the more they remain the same!"

"The world is moving at a tremendous rate.  No one knows where.  We must prepare our children not for the world of the past, not for our world, but for their world. 
The world of the future."  --John Dewey
